We investigated the effect of endoplasmic reticulum (ER) protein 29 (ERp29) on thyroglobulin (Tg) secretion and its negative regulation by microRNAs (miRNAs). ERp29 overexpression promoted Tg secretion from thyrocytes of PCCL3 cells via activation of ER stress sensors, including activation of transcription factor 6 fragmentation, XBP1 mRNA splicing by inositol-requiring enzyme 1, and phosphorylation of eukaryotic initiation factor 2 alpha as downstream actions of RNA-dependent protein kinase-like ER kinase.

Leucine decarboxylase (LDC) is a recently proposed enzyme with no official enzyme commission number yet. It is encoded by the Mus musculus gene Gm853 which is expressed at kidneys, generating isopentylamine, an alkylmonoamine that has not been described to be formed by any metazoan enzyme yet. Although the relevance of LDC in mammalian physiology has not been fully determined, isopentylamine is a potential modulator which may have effects on insulin secretion and healthy gut microbiota formation.

Sedolisins are acid proteases that are related to the basic subtilisins. They have been identified in all three superkingdoms but are not ubiquitous, although fungi that secrete acids as part of their lifestyle can have up to six paralogs.

Small-cell lung cancer (SCLC) is known to express antigens of both the neural crest and epithelium, and to secrete polypeptide hormones and enzymes. Anecdotal reports correlate lung cancer with marked hyperamylasemia, and a review of the literature reveals only one case of metastatic SCLC linked to high paraneoplastic lipase production.

Aspergillus oryzae, a safe filamentous fungus, is widely used in food and enzyme production. In this study, we examined a cultivation model using rice husks as carrier to assess the capacity of recombinant protein production in A. oryzae. The model was first tested with the A. oryzae strain expressing the DsRed reporter gene. The expression of DsRed was easily detected by the pink color of the fungal mycelium on culture media and under a fluorescence microscope. The model was then evaluated with the phyA gene encoding a phytase from the fungus Aspergillus fumigatus.

The plant cell wall serves as a primary barrier against pathogen invasion. The success of a plant pathogen largely depends on its ability to overcome this barrier. During the infection process, plant parasitic nematodes secrete cell wall degrading enzymes (CWDEs) apart from piercing with their stylet, a sharp and hard mouthpart used for successful infection.
